The Speedway Sparkplugs are taking a road trip to square off against the Bethesda Christian Patriots at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Speedway is coming into the contest on a five-game losing streak.
Speedway is likely headed into the matchup with a focus on the second half, which is when things went downhill against Lebanon on Saturday. The game between Speedway and Lebanon didn't end well, with Speedway falling 69-51. While losing is never fun, the Sparkplugs can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Indiana basketball rankings (they are ranked 379th, while the Tigers are ranked 98th).
Meanwhile, Bethesda Christian was not able to break out of their rough patch on Saturday as the team picked up their fifth straight loss. They were six points away from ending the streak, but they lost a 48-42 heartbreaker at the hands of Seeger. While Bethesda Christian didn't get the win, they did start the game off strong, beating Seeger 12-8 in the first quarter.
Bethesda Christian's defeat dropped their record down to 5-12. As for Speedway, their loss dropped their record down to 2-13.
Speedway suffered a grim 74-51 defeat to Bethesda Christian when the teams last played back in February of 2024. Thankfully for Speedway, Luke Douglas (who went 9 of 16 en route to 24 points) won't be suiting up this time. Will that be enough to change the final result?
